> At this point:
> 1) delete the SMALLDS, it is empty.
> 2) re-init the volume with appropriate VTOC/VTOCIX
> 3) redefine the SMALLDS and prime it.
> 4) Add the volume back into HSM for use.

>>>> > 1) AFAIK there is no way to re-size the VTOCIX except  a BUILDIX
>>>> OSVTOC/BUILDIX IXVTOC  sequence.
>>>> >
>>>> > Specifically an example (slightly modified from the manual
>>>>  "GC35-0033-39 Device Support Facilities (ICKDSF) User's Guide and
>>>> Reference"):
>>>> >
>>>> > //jobname JOB
>>>> > //STEP1  EXEC PGM=ICKDSF,PARM='NOREPLYU'
>>>> > //SYSPRINT DD SYSOUT=A
>>>> > //DDCARD DD UNIT=(3390,,DEFER),VOL=(PRIVATE,SER=VL3390),
>>>> > // DISP=OLD
>>>> > //SYSIN DD *
>>>> > BUILDIX DDNAME(DDCARD) OS PURGE
>>>>  <-----------------------------------------------------------------
>>>> Deletes the existing index
>>>> > /*
>>>> > //STEP2 EXEC PGM=ICKDSF
>>>> > //SYSPRINT DD SYSOUT=A
>>>> > //VOLDD DD UNIT=(3390,,DEFER),VOL=(PRIVATE,SER=339003),  <--------
>>>> ----------------------------Allocates a new index.
>>>> > // DSN=SYS1.VTOCIX.V39003,DISP=(NEW,KEEP),
>>>> > // SPACE=(TRK,10,,CONTIG)
>>>> > //SYSIN DD *
>>>> > BUILDIX DDNAME(VOLDD) IXVTOC
>>>> > /*
